i've got a 1998 2wd dodge dakota, and want to lower it, probably 2"-4" or 3"-5" (not bag, out of budget) but i have no idea where to start, i have heard the terms coilovers, leaflets,shocks. if possible, i'd like to know about how much it would be if i installed it myself, or had a professional do it. thanks, any info is appreciated.

 
In the front you can get control arms or springs or spindles, and in the back u can get a flip kit or shackles or hangers......it will probly be a few hundred 100-300 for installation depending on what hardware you choose to drop it with.
